CSIR’s newly developed Disinfection technology

In News

CSIR’s newly developed disinfection technology is being installed to combat the pandemic in railway coaches, AC buses, closed spaces, etc.

About technology

  • Disinfection technology is effective for the mitigation of airborne transmission of SARS-COV-2 and will also remain relevant in the post-COVID era. 
  • UV-C deactivates viruses, bacteria, fungus and other bioaerosols with appropriate dosages using 254nm UV light.
  • UV-C air duct disinfection systems can be used in auditoriums, large conference rooms, classrooms, malls, etc. which provides a relatively safer environment for indoor activities in the current pandemic.
  • The disinfection technologies for handling COVID waste from its separate collection to various physical and chemical treatment steps have been reviewed.
